About P. K. Sharp

P. K. Sharp is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Mechanics of Materials, Civil and Structural Engineering, Statistics, Probability and Uncertainty and Materials Chemistry, having authored 28 papers that have together received 602 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Fatigue and fracture mechanics (15 papers), Surface Treatment and Residual Stress (7 papers), High Entropy Alloys Studies (6 papers), Additive Manufacturing Materials and Processes (6 papers), Probabilistic and Robust Engineering Design (5 papers), Mechanical Failure Analysis and Simulation (5 papers), Non-Destructive Testing Techniques (4 papers) and Fire effects on concrete materials (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Metals and Alloys (52 citations), Mechanical Engineering (508 citations), Automotive Engineering (163 citations), Ecological Modeling (50 citations) and Mechanics of Materials (232 citations). P. K. Sharp has collaborated with scholars based in Australia, Norway and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Graham Clark, Milan Brandt, Joe Elambasseril, Martin Leary, Shoujin Sun, Simon Barter, Weichao Zhuang, Anna Paradowska, Geoffrey Holden and Chris Loader. Their work appears in journals such as Fatigue & Fracture of Engineering Materials & Structures, International Journal of Fatigue, Applied Surface Science, Engineering Failure Analysis and Advanced materials research.
